问题标签 [amazon-efs]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
4628 浏览

amazon-web-services - EBS 与 EFS 读写延迟

我将用户的代码存储在文件系统中,目前是 AWS 中的 EBS。我正在寻求提高可用性,并希望减少由于 EBS 下降而导致中断的机会。EFS 似乎是一个合理的选择。

我知道 EFS 会比 EBS 慢,而且 EFS 比 EBS 贵。我想知道,是否有任何性能基准来衡量EFS的读写延迟并与EBS进行比较?

0 投票
1 回答
3339 浏览

amazon-web-services - 如何监控特定文件并在 AWS EFS 中触发 AWS Lambda 函数?

我有一个大型机(MF),它在我的 EFS 位置(比如 /temp/mf 目录,文件名 test.txt)放置一个文件

我想要一个文件触发器(可以是任何 AWS 服务)来检测文件(test.txt),只要它可用并且在 30 秒内没有更改,以确保 MF 已完成对文件的写入,然后触发 lambda 函数.

我怎样才能做到这一点?

0 投票
2 回答
536 浏览

java - AWS不同区域的数据和数据库存储

我正在开发一种可在世界不同地区访问的医疗产品,并从患者那里收集数据,根据分销法,我不能将患者数据、历史或记录带到另一个国家。基本要求是美国站点应将所有相关数据存储在美国数据中心(例如当前的美国东部数据中心),欧盟站点应将所有数据存储在欧盟数据中心(例如 AWS 爱尔兰或法兰克福)。

应该分析这是如何最有效地完成的 - 运行两个完全不同的堆栈?还是应该在这些不同的位置设置一个数据库和 EFS 系统?

0 投票
2 回答
15278 浏览

amazon-web-services - 如何将 AWS EFS 挂载到 Macbook 或本地计算机

我正在尝试将 AWS EFS 安装到我的本地 MacBook(以及其他本地计算机)但是,它不起作用。

我的 22 和 2049 端口作为测试完全开放。

我尝试了几个命令 mount -t nfs4 -o nfservers=4.1 xxx.xxx.xxx.xxx:/ efs/

但我不断收到connection timed out错误消息。

我还尝试将此 EFS 挂载到另一个 AWS 账户 EC2 实例。但不断收到同样的错误。

例如,我在 Account1 中有 EFS,在 Account2 中有 EC2(不同的 VPC)并尝试:

除非我的 EC2 在同一个帐户(即 account1)中,否则它不起作用。

有没有办法可以将此 EFS 挂载到不同的帐户或本地计算机上?

0 投票
0 回答
108 浏览

php - 将 cookie 存储在数据库而不是文件中的缺点是什么?

我正在开发位于客户端和 API 之间的服务。客户端用户通过我的服务执行 API 请求。API 需要设置多个用户 cookie 来验证用户并允许请求。客户端无法存储 cookie,因此我将所有 cookie 存储在 AWS EFS 上。该服务是用 PHP 编写的,API 请求是使用 cURL 完成的。Cookie 处理是使用 cURLCURLOPT_COOKIEFILECURLOPT_COOKIEJAR.

问题是有时 cookie 文件会被覆盖而不是附加或更新,从而导致 API 请求失败。我仍在尝试查找导致此问题的原因,但我正在考虑将 cookie 保存到数据库而不是文件中。显然这会导致数据库负载增加,但我想不出任何其他缺点。有吗?

0 投票
0 回答
637 浏览

amazon-web-services - EFS 卷未安装在 Elastic Beanstalk 上的 Docker 容器上

我无法在 Elastic Beanstalk 上运行的 Docker 容器上挂载 EFS 卷。这是我所拥有的Dockerrun.aws.json

这是我在.ebextensions/storage-efs-mountfilesystem.config. 其余与此相同。

当我 ssh 进入我的 Elastic Beanstalk 环境时,我看到该卷已安装在主机上:

但在我的 Docker 容器中,文件系统不是 EFS:

VOLUMEDockerfile.

此外,如果我在 Docker 容器中创建了一个文件,那么当我返回主机目录时,该文件就不存在了。因此, /mydir不是来自主机卷。我还需要做什么才能访问 Docker 上的 EFS 卷?

0 投票
2 回答
902 浏览

amazon-web-services - 哪种 AWS 服务最适合静态文件

哪种 AWS 服务最适合静态内容 - HTML、JavaScript、图像、JSON、PDF、Excel、文本文件和应用程序日志。

S3 或 EFS 或 EBS

价格不是问题,但要寻找最可靠、安全和高吞吐量的(我的是美国唯一的 webapp)。

0 投票
1 回答
700 浏览

amazon-web-services - 在多个 Linux 和 Windows 实例之间共享 EFS 块

我需要一个我的 Linux 实例(大约 5 个)和单个 Windows 实例可以读/写的地方。我想过使用 EFS 块,它适用于 Linux 实例。我可以将它安装在多个 Linux 实例上,它们都可以很好地协同工作。但是我需要将相同的 EFS 块共享给 Windows 实例,并且根据官方 AWS 文档,Windows 不支持 EFS 块。

那么,是否可以将我的 EFS 块安装在 Linux 实例上的目录上,然后通过 Samba 与我的 Windows 实例共享该目录?

如果没有,那么我的选择是什么?

0 投票
0 回答
413 浏览

wordpress - 在 Elastic Beanstalk 上从 EFS 运行 Wordpress

我对 AWS 世界还很陌生,我想知道在 Elastic beanstalk from 和 EFS mount 上运行可扩展的 wordpress 安装的限制。

我让文件系统能够正确挂载,但如何才能让 Elastic Beanstalk 将应用程序部署到 EFS 文件夹?我可以将 EFS 挂载到 /var/www/html 吗?或者有没有办法切换文档根目录说.. /var/www/wordpress 并让 Elastic Beanstalk 在那里部署应用程序?...任何方向都会得到极大的赞赏

0 投票
2 回答
3287 浏览

wordpress - AWS EFS 的性能下降

我们已经通过自动缩放和 EFS 在 aws ec2 上托管了我们的 wordpress 站点。但是突然之间,PermittedThroughput 变得接近零字节,并且 BurstCreditBalance 变得越来越少(从 2TB 到几 Mbs!)。EFS 大小只有 2GB 左右!我们第二次面临这个问题。我想知道是否有人对这种情况有类似的经验或任何建议。计划在未来几天从 EFS 转移到 NFS 或 glusterfs。

cloudwatch graphp

在此处输入图像描述